随着区块链技术的不断发展,越来越多的区块链钱包开始进入市场,并为用户提供安全、便捷的加密货币管理服务。...
随着区块链技术的发展,数字货币的使用日益广泛,用户对于钱包的安全性要求也不断提升。多重签名加密钱包(Multisignature Wallet)应运而生,成为了保障数字资产安全的重要工具。本文将从多重签名的概念、工作原理、优缺点,以及如何选择和使用多重签名钱包等方面进行详细介绍,并探讨相关的实际问题。
多重签名钱包是一种需要多个密钥来进行交易验证的钱包。这意味着,用户不是单独依赖于一个私钥来确认交易,而是需要多个私钥的配合。这种方法提供了额外的安全层,尤其适合企业、合作社以及需要多人共同管理资产的场景。
在一个典型的多重签名设置中,可以有N个密钥,其中M个密钥必须签署一笔交易才能生效。常见的配置有2-of-3或者3-of-5,即三把钥匙中,任意两把就可以授权交易,或五把钥匙中,任意三把可以进行交易。通过这种方式,即使某个密钥被盗,也不至于导致资产的完全损失。
多重签名钱包的工作原理基于公钥密码学,以下是其基本步骤:
1. **创建钱包**:在创建一个多重签名钱包时,用户(或组织)会生成多个私钥和相应的公钥,并定义需要多少个密钥来共同授权交易。
2. **交易发起**:当用户需要进行交易时,可以通过任意一个私钥发起交易。发起者会创建一个未签名的交易,并附带需要的签名数量。
3. **交易签名**:接下来,交易需要由其他私钥持有者进行签名,这个过程可以通过相应的钱包软件实现。每个签名会被添加到交易信息中。
4. **交易广播**:一旦收集到所需数量的签名,交易可以被广播到区块链网络中进行处理。
如同所有技术,使用多重签名钱包也有其优缺点:
选择和使用多重签名钱包时,可以根据以下因素进行考虑:
市场上有多种多重签名钱包软件可供选择。用户需要首先确认所选的钱包是否支持多重签名,并兼容自身需要的区块链类型(如比特币、以太坊等)。
选择那些经过验证和安全审核的钱包,有些钱包甚至提供专业的安全措施,如硬件加密和多重身份认证等、减少潜在的安全隐患。
用户界面的友好程度对于非技术用户尤为重要,选择一个界面设计合理且流程简易的钱包能够减少使用上的障碍。
确认钱包提供安全的备份恢复选项,以防丢失私钥导致无法访问资金的情况。
多重签名钱包能够通过要求多个签名来确保交易的安全性。在这种情况下,如果某个私钥被盗,在未获得其他签名的情况下,资金仍然是安全的。比如,在2-of-3的钱包中,如果攻击者获得了其中一个私钥,仍需其他两个签名才能完成交易。即使攻击者控制了一个账户,只要其他账户的持有者保持冷静且有效,资金便不会受到威胁。
此外,多重签名钱包还允许用户制定授权规则,内部资金管理更为安全。例如,财务部经理和CTO都可以设置为需要签名,任何一方都无法独立决定资金流动,有效防止了恶意行为及内部欺诈。从这个意义上看,多重签名钱包极大地提升了资产的安全性。
由于多重签名钱包需要多个持有者共同授权,因此在实际操作中,如何确保协作顺畅非常重要。首先,用户需建立清晰的沟通机制,确保所有参与者知道何时何地需要签署交易。同时,可以使用协作工具来追踪每个参与者的签名状态,避免遗漏和混乱。
其次,可利用治理机制来设定责任,明确各角色的权限,有助于团队更为高效地操作资金。例如,可以设定某些人负责控制钱包,其他人负责监控交易,确保每一步都有相应的人负责,这有助于避免不必要的误会。
另外,定期地进行资金和签名的审查也是保持团队高效合作的一部分,通过回顾和改进流程,逐步协作体验。
虽然多重签名钱包在理论上能提供更高的安全性,但实际上对普通用户来说,使用的技术壁垒仍然不少。首先,多重签名钱包的生成及交易签名的过程相对复杂,普通用户可能会在步骤上感到困惑。此外,了解公钥密码学等技术背景,对一些非技术用户来说可能难度不小。
其次,备份和恢复流程也可能存在挑战,如何安全地存储和管理各签名密钥至关重要,用户如果未能妥善管理,一旦丢失某个密钥,可能会导致无法访问相应的资金。如果有用户还不具备良好的备份意识,缺乏足够的安全防范,甚至会导致损失。
因此,为了降低技术壁垒,钱包方需提供清晰的使用教学和客户支持,确保用户可以在便捷的环境中合理利用多重签名钱包带来的安全优势。
在总结来说,多重签名加密钱包凭借其独特的安全机制,正逐渐成为越来越多用户的选择,在提升安全性的同时若能不断体验,那么它无疑能够为数字资产管理提供强有力的保障。